Let me introduce you to Butter Cake, a gentle soul with all the makings of a perfect companion. She can come off a touch shy when you first meet here but just because she isn’t clamoring for your attention. Butter isn’t the pushy type, she is quiet presence, that feels good from the start and only gets better. Butter has all the traits of an adoring, loyal dog and she is ready to come home. Take a look and then come back to read more- https://youtu.be/C3lOenrz_Cw Butter is estimated to be 1.5 years old, weighs 52 lbs, and may be a shepherd/pittie mix. Breed and age are details we cannot offer 100% certainty on given the nature of her being a rescue . We believe she is fully grown which means she is the perfect midsize gal in our opinion and has the presence and peacefulness of a much older dog. From what we have seen and her foster has shared, Butter has a slow and steady approach to life. Whether it is with people, on-leash for a walk, meeting new dogs, or meeting our house cat, she is polite and gentle. We suspect that she may need a little time to warm up to the other dogs in the home if she is a +1 for your current dog, but she could easily be fulfilled as an only dog. Shyness aside, her approach is polite and friendly, perfect for building a connection. As she has met more and more dogs it has been easy to see that her best connections are with dogs that have a calm presence, they can have but a playful energy without being pushy. Many pushy dogs have tried to get her to play by bouncing in her face and pawing at her, she is tolerant of it but has yet to take the bait. In addition to being dog friendly, Butter was cautiously respectful of our resident house cat, she was aware of his presence but kept her distance. From what we saw Butter is cat-tolerant and would be a peaceful addition to a home with feline friends, especially if she had a doggie friend to match mer occasional playful moments. Butters ideal home would be a quiet one, ideally a home with a yard away from the hustle and bustle of city life. Her quiet presence and leash skills tell me she would make a wonderful after-dinner walking buddy. Butter is ready to quietly take on learning all about a beautiful life with you by her side. Our adoption fees reflect the extensive care and resources that go into each animal we save. The adoption fee is a donation to the mission and goes far beyond getting a fully vetted pet. The rescue’s hard costs alone (excluding transport) for a healthy dog to go through our program typically range between $412 to $859, which includes boarding, food, medications, vaccines, and spay/neuter. For heartworm-positive dogs, hard costs are upwards of $1,368. Additionally, dogs requiring extended boarding, extra training, or extra medical care—such as dental work, vision care, or orthopedic care—can lead to expenses running into the thousands. Also, included in the adoption fee are costs to cover transport up to the Pacific Northwest or East Coast. Transport is a significant additional expense to the rescue. While adoption fees help cover part of these expenses, we want to emphasize that the rescue does not receive government funding and must fundraise to offset the remaining expense balance which ranges $100-1,000++ per animal on these direct costs.
